The incircle of triangle $ABC$ touches $BC,CA,AB$ at $D,E,F$ respectively . The circle passing through $A$ and touching the line $BC$ at $D$ intersects $BF$ and $CE$ at points $K$ and $L$ respectively . The line passing through $E$ and parallel to $DL$ and the line passing through $F$ and parallel to $DK$ intersects at $P$ .
Let $R_1,R_2,R_3,R_4$ be circumradius of $\Delta AFD, \Delta AED , \Delta FPD , \Delta EPD $ . Find the value of $k$ for which $R_1R_4=k . R_2R_3$ .
